Best Valentine’s Day Gift for a Husband

B

Valentine’s Day is a magnificent day to expect love. Especially if you’ve had marriage problems recently, avoid the trap of expecting chocolates or dinner or jewelry or something romantic. Your chances of expecting the right thing are tiny. Your chances of missing out on love when you expect some particular sign of it are great.
The best gift you can give your husband on Valentine’s day is to expect love and welcome it with open arms, no matter what form it might take. Genuine appreciation and acceptance means more than just about anything you could buy or make on February 14th.
